Massive Storage Capacity for Backups and Archives
Storage servers have one main job , providing tons of disk space for backups, archives, media collections, whatever you need storing long-term. These aren’t about having powerful processors or massive RAM; they’re about offering enormous storage capacity at reasonable per-terabyte pricing.
